Description: IsoSketch is a free, open-source isometric graphic design tool and vector drawing application. It allows users to easily create isometric illustrations, diagrams, prototyping designs, and more using an intuitive drag-and-drop interface.

Description: TriangleDraw is a free, open-source software for drawing triangles of various types. It allows you to easily construct equilateral, isosceles, scalene, right, acute and obtuse triangles by specifying side lengths and angles. Useful for geometry students, teachers, and hobbyists.
